Our electric radiators can be individually controlled allowing you to set … WebStorage heaters Traditional electric heating uses storage heaters. Usually they heat up overnight and gradually release the heat over the following day. They're designed to keep your home warm for the whole day. But, once the heat runs out, you may have to wait until the next night for them to reheat. WebODE is turn–key in dealing with Home Heating Oil projects.
